The learning environment of any university must be suitable for its students

When the learning environment is not suitable, retention rate decrease

There are different factors that affect the learning environment

Teachers and staff members can increase the rate of retention by being more considerate

The learning resources and equipment can also affect the rate or retention

The main reason why students seek to enroll in Universities is to make sure that they acquire the skills that they need to build their career (Seidman, 2019). Therefore, it means that when the learning environment frustrates the students from achieving their goals, they opt to leave for other Universities. The people who deal with the students also have an impact on the rate of retention. When they are good to the students, the students opt to stay instead of leaving for another University.

Activities, initiatives, or strategies

Engaging students in the school decision making process.

The use of sports activities that bring students together and make them feel like equal members of the institution.

Promote a positive and friendly attitude from the teachers and staff members

Activities that bring the members of staff and the students together will help in providing a solution for the problem. It is imperative to note that relationships are essential in institutions and when they are fostered, they might discourage the students from leaving. Engaging the students in the decision making process of the University is also another strategy that will help in finding a solution to the problem.
